EXPO 2005 Aichi Japan
" Iceland Day" & " Icelandic Art Festival in Chiryu 2005" Report
Tuesday, July 12 to Monday, July 18, 2005
Many artists, school staff members, and government officials came to Japan from Iceland around July 15, which was “Iceland Day” at EXPO 2005 Aichi Japan. A total of about 110 people stayed in Chiryu during that period, and concerts and performances were held.
In particular, members of the Kársness School Choir and Skálholt Cathedral Choir interacted with citizens at various places throughout the period and played a primary role in “citizen communication,” which was the purpose of the expo friendship project. Centering on communication between the choirs and citizens, the friendship project of Iceland and Chiryu are reviewed.
